Shortening days in The Hague through December 1806

Across December 1806, daylight in The Hague, Netherlands shortens — the month opens with 8h 06m of daylight and closes with 7h 47m (a swing of about 19 minutes). Expect a change of around 4 minutes from one week to the next.

Look for the year's local extremes here: sunrise as early as 07:46 on December 1 and as late as 08:10 on December 27, with sunset from 15:48 (December 10) to 15:57 (December 31).

On an average day this month The Hague sees about 7h 49m of daylight. Handy for photographers, early risers, travellers and anyone timing their day to the light in The Hague.

What is the difference between sunrise and sunset?

Sunrise is the moment the sun's top edge first appears above the horizon in the morning; sunset is when it disappears below the horizon in the evening. The gap between them is the day's length, which shifts gradually through the year.

Are the sunrise and sunset times for The Hague accurate?

Times are calculated from the location's exact latitude, longitude and time zone using standard astronomical algorithms, accurate to about a minute. Local terrain such as hills or tall buildings can slightly shift when the sun actually appears or disappears.
